After an enforced three year hiatus from physical venues due to the pandemic, Glasgow Short Film Festival (GSFF) recently made its long-awaited return to in-person screenings between the 23rd and the 27th March 2022.

The ground floor of Civic House was utilised as a Festival Hub for this 15th edition of GSFF, providing a perfect setting for the programme’s industry and social events – as well as being a convenient alternative venue for a portion of the screenings themselves.

The diner and dance floor aesthetic of the Kitchen encapsulates the smart in the front, party in the back attitude. Equally adept as a formal locale for the Delegates Dinner, as it was for the fun of Ringo Music Bingo, Happy Hour drinks, and even a DJ set from KTAB.

During the pandemic, the Project Space was constructed fully – creating an enclosed, partitioned space between the Kitchen and Venue. GSFF chose to utilise this room by transforming it into a Box Office and Guest Desk away from the surrounding hubbub.

The largest of the ground floor spaces, GSFF were keen to explore the full potential of the Venue. Its well-lit nature provided the perfect backdrop to more talk-oriented listings such as Meet the Festivals and a Panel Discussion, while its blackout blinds were utilised for screenings like Camille & Ulysse, The End, Eco-Spectrality, and For Shorts and Giggles.
